XMR isn't available on many CEXs, and this leads to the only option being to use DEXs or instant exchanges for conversion. That is the reason exchanges raise the XMR trading fee as they know that the trader do not have much options. I didn't like the fact when eXch increased the XMR fee to 5%. That was too much fee to pay for conversion. If any instant exchange wants to become popular, they should charge lower fees and rates close to the centralized exchanges, and they will get many customers.  Smiley
In this particular case, the fee increase on XMR was not a matter of the greed of the exchangers, but was largely influenced by the higher demand for Monero and the need for the exchangers to buy elsewhere in order to cover as much of the requirements for XMR as possible.
As far as I remember, in addition to the "high" fee on the sale of XMR, there was often a lack of quantity that the market demanded

Stats for August

Stats for searches on OrangeFren.com in August👀

Why is Bitcoin below 25%? Why are people moving to USDC?

XMR: 42.76%
BTC: 24.73%
LTC: 7.82%
ETH: 7.33%
USDT: 5.76%
USDC: 2.73%
SOL: 1.84%
ZEC: 1.09%
BTCLN: 1.06%
TRX: 0.55%
DOGE: 0.41%
ZANO: 0.33%
XRP: 0.32%
DAI: 0.32%
FIRO: 0.26%
BNB: 0.22%
BCH: 0.17%
ADA: 0.15%
